Web1 day ago · The stromal antigen 2 (STAG2) gene, located on chromosome Xq25, is a core component of the cohesin complex that functions on chromatin organization, transcriptional regulation, and postreplicative DNA repair. 1-3, STAG2 mutations (STAG2ms) are reported in 5% to 10% of myeloid neoplasms (MNs), mostly high-risk myelodysplastic syndrome …

WebCytogenetics is essentially a branch of genetics, but is also a part of cell biology/cytology (a subdivision of human anatomy), that is concerned with how the chromosomes relate to cell behaviour, particularly to their behaviour during mitosis and meiosis. WebDec 2, 2016 · The Atlas of Genetics and Cytogenetics in Oncology and Haematology, which was established in 1997, is a peer-reviewed, open access, online journal, encyclopedia, and database that is devoted to genes, cytogenetics, and clinical entities in cancer and cancer-prone diseases. WebCytogenetics The analysis of G-banded chromosomes (karyotyping) to identify structural and numerical abnormalities – translocations, inversions, duplications, aneuploidy, polyploidy.
